Advice for new EKG techs:

Trust your knowledge and build your confidence over time, stay calm and take deep breaths when you start to get busy

Stay humble, ask for help

No one comes out of school knowing everything, you need to know your limits

Regardless of your role, don’t be afraid to advocate for the patient

Providers need to remember to project an approachable demeaner so that everyone has a level of comfort bringing things to their attention

It’s important to take your job seriously and do it to the best of your ability

If you are looking into getting into medicine, look at EMT or EKG tech. They both give you a great insight into the greater medicine world

There are a lot of great jobs that introduce you to medicine before you take the risk of PA school or medical school

Sometimes the only way to really understand what you are getting into is to get into the field instead of reading about it or watching videos about it
